Bedouin silver jewellery, crafted with intricate patterns and ancient tactics, is often a testomony on the wealthy cultural heritage from the nomadic Bedouin tribes who have inhabited the deserts of Egypt and North Africa for hundreds of years. This exquisite art variety, handed down by means of generations, provides a glimpse to the Bedouin method of everyday living, their beliefs, and their relationship on the organic world.
The Art of Bedouin Silver Jewellery
Bedouin silver jewelry is often made out of sterling silver, that is normally sourced locally or traded with neighboring tribes. The artisans use common tactics such as repoussé, engraving, and filigree to create intricate models which can be both useful and aesthetically satisfying. Widespread motifs include geometric designs, stars, crescents, and symbols symbolizing nature, which include camels, palm trees, along with the Sunlight.
Bedouin Tribes and Their Jewellery
The Bedouin tribes of Egypt and North Africa, such as the Rashaida tribes south of Egypt, Every have their unique unique types of jewelry. The jewellery worn by Gals often reflects their social standing, marital standing, and personal Choices. One example is, a bride may perhaps put on elaborate necklaces and earrings adorned with treasured stones, even though a married lady may well have on more simple parts that are much more useful for lifestyle.
Egyptian Bedouin:
Known for their bold and colorful jewellery, Egyptian Bedouin normally include turquoise, coral, and various gemstones into their designs. Their necklaces and earrings are often large and assertion-earning, reflecting the colourful lifestyle in the Nile Valley.
North African Bedouin:
Bedouin tribes in North Africa, such as the Tuareg, have a far more minimalist sort of jewellery. Their items are frequently produced with intricate Traditional silver jewelry filigree function and they are meant to be at ease and functional for life in the desert.
Rashaida Bedouin:
The Rashaida tribes, who inhabit the Pink Sea coast, have a particular variety of jewelry that comes with both equally Bedouin and Sudanese influences. Their items often aspect bold geometric styles and so are adorned with colorful beads and shells.
